Hi, there is a problem whith this script: # ngctl ls | awk '{ if ($4 == "l2tp") print $6}' ngctl: send msg: No buffer space available Sami 2012/1/5 Gleb Smirnoff <glebius@freebsd.org> > Sami, > > I'm trying to reproduce a reordering problem with a new node, and > I've found that: > > 1) PPTP uses sequencing, that would not pass out of sequence datagram > to the PPP, and thus to MPPE. > 2) L2TP uses sequencing optionally, so the problem in subject may > appear only on an L2TP link with disabled sequencing. > > I wonder how often L2TP is running w/o sequencing control. Can you > please run this script on your mpd box to estimate? > > #!/bin/sh > > IDS=$(ngctl ls | awk '{ if ($4 == "l2tp") print $6}') > for id in $IDS; do > id="[$id]:"; > sess=$(ngctl show $id | sed -En 's/.*session_([0-9a-f]+).*/\1/p'); > ngctl msg $id getsessconfig 0x$sess > done > > In my small installation I've got only a couple of L2TP clients, and both > use sequencing, so patched code in ng_mppc won't be ever executed. > > Rec'd response "getsessconfig" (4) from "[11f]:": > Args: { session_id=0xafb6 peer_id=0x2fcf control_dseq=1 enable_dseq=1 } > Rec'd response "getsessconfig" (4) from "[f3]:": > Args: { session_id=0xd34b peer_id=0x2654 control_dseq=1 enable_dseq=1 } > > I'd like to explicitly test the code in ng_mppc to make sure, that node > can rekey up to 4096 times and continue operation. > > -- > Totus tuus, Glebius. > -- Sami Halabi Information Systems Engineer NMS Projects Expert
